The Flood Water Extraction Process: What to Expect
Proper Flood Water Extraction needs a step-by-step approach to ensure complete water removal and prevent further damage. Our team follows a proven process that includes:
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Inspecting the affected area to identify the source and extent of the damage. Our technicians will document the water level and take photos to support your insurance claim. We’ll develop a customized plan to extract water and dry your property.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using industrial-grade pumps to extract water from the affected area. Our technicians will remove wet materials and dry the area to prevent further damage and growth of mold and mildew.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Using specialized equipment to dry the affected area, including dehumidifiers and air movers. Our technicians will monitor the moisture levels to ensure your property is d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
Removing any remaining debris and disinfecting the area to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. Our technicians will use environmentally friendly cleaning products to ensure your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Report
Inspecting the affected area to ensure all water has been removed and the area is dry. Our technicians will prepare a detailed report to support your insurance claim and ensure a smooth recovery process.

Warning Signs You Need Flood Water Extraction
Ignoring these warning signs can lead to costly repairs and potential health hazards. Be aware of: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home or business, it’s time to call us.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Visible signs of water damage on your flooring can lead to costly repairs. If you notice warping or buckling of your floors, it’s essential to address the issue quickly.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Water stains can show a more significant problem. If you notice water stains on your walls and ceilings, don’t ignore them, call us today.
Peeling Paint and Wallpaper
Peeling paint and w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these symptoms, it’s time to act and prevent further damage.
Discoloration of Drywall and Wooden Trim
Discoloration of your drywall and wooden trim can show water damage. Don’t delay, call us to assess and repair the damage.
Flood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standing water in the basement | Yes | No | DIY extraction is usually safe and effective for small areas. |
| Water damage to electrical systems | No | Yes | Electrical systems can be hazardous, and improper handling can lead to costly repairs or even safety risks. |
| Musty odors and mold growth | No | Yes | Mold growth can be a health hazard, and DIY cleaning may not be effective in removing all mold and mildew. |
| Water damage to structural elements | No | Yes | Structural elements, such as beams and joists, can be damaged by water, needing professional attention to ensure safety and prevent further damage. |
| Large areas of water damage | No | Yes | Large areas of water damage need specialized equipment and expertise to extract water and dry the affected area safely and effectively. |
| Hidden water damage | Unknown | Yes | Hidden water damage can be challenging to detect, and a professional assessment is recommended to ensure all affected areas are identified and addressed. |

Common Questions About Flood Water Extraction
How long does Flood Water Extraction take?
Extraction time varies depending on the size of the affected area and the complexity of the job. Our team will provide a detailed timeline and ensure a smooth recovery process.
Will my insurance cover Flood Water Extraction?
Insurance coverage varies depending on your policy and the cause of the flood. Our team will work with you to document damage and ensure a seamless insurance claim process.
Is Flood Water Extraction a DIY job?
Not always. While small areas of water damage may be safe for DIY extraction, larger areas or complex jobs need professional attention to ensure safety and prevent further damage.
How do I prevent Flood Water Extraction in the future?
Regular maintenance can help prevent Flood Water Extraction. Be aware of potential risks, such as clogged drains and faulty appliances, and address them quickly to avoid costly repairs.
Can I use a wet/dry vacuum for Flood Water Extraction?
Not recommended. Wet/dry vacuums are not designed for large-scale water extraction and may not be effective in removing all water. Our team will use industrial-grade equipment to ensure a thorough and safe extraction process.
